Fact Check: The Narrative is Misleading

While official court records and statements from prosecutors do verify that Corie Walsh followed and talked about the Lindsay Clancy trial leading up to the incident, the claim that the trial caused the murder is misleading.
Available evidence does not establish a direct cause-and-effect relationship between the trial and the mother’s actions. At this stage, the connection remains an observation mentioned in legal proceedings rather than proof of influence.
The tragedy deeply shook Frankfort, a quiet, affluent community located roughly 35 miles southwest of Chicago. Earlier in the week, authorities discovered young Barrett Walsh hanging in the basement of the home.
Investigators also found Corie Walsh in a bathtub showing signs of an apparent suicide attempt. On Friday, September 4, local police formally charged her with three counts of first-degree murder.
In a legal filing requesting that Walsh be held without bond, prosecutors noted that she had “recently become very invested in the Lindsay Clancy murder trial.”
Clancy, who faced charges tied to the 2023 deaths of her three children, has remained in the national spotlight due to her livestreamed trial, which ultimately resulted in a mistrial.
